    Abstract: A pathogen detection method. A sample that potentially contains a pathogen is collected. A triangle wave form output is produced. A signal associated with the triangle wave form is transmitted from a voltage-controlled oscillator over a plurality of frequencies. The signal is transmitted through the sample to cause the pathogen in the sample to vibrate at a frequency. The vibrations from the sample are detected. A resonance profile of a pathogen in the sample is calculated based upon the vibrations. A database that includes a resonance profile signature of at least one pathogens is provided. The calculated resonance profile is compared to the resonance profile signature database to determine if the sample includes the pathogen.

    Abstract: A method of detecting threats. A threat detection system is provided that includes a controller, a millimeter wave radar with transceiver, a signature database, and a camera. The signature database or machine learning includes time and frequency domain characteristic data for a threat. A signal is emitted by the millimeter wave radar. A return signal is received when the signal bounces off an object. Time and frequency domain characteristic data of the return signal is compared to the signature database, or the machine learned characteristics to determine the threat, anomaly, foreign object, material characteristics, and threat speech recognition.

    Abstract: A variable operational mode transceiver device formed with an integrated circuit having a semiconductor material substrate supporting a feedback oscillator having a signal power divider electrically coupled to said feedback oscillator output, and a signal frequency multiplier electrically coupled to said signal power divider. A signal mixer has a pair of inputs of which one is electrically coupled to that remaining one of said pair of outputs of said signal power divider.
